Sock takes down McGuffin in singles thriller


Round of 16 action got underway today at the PPA Mesa Arizona Cup and fans were treated to spectacular matches across all five events. From start to finish there was drama all around the grounds so let’s get into results and take a look at who will made their way into the quarterfinals.

Men’s Singles: Sock Setups Clash with Cinderella Story 

Jack Sock started off the day with an impressive performance as he took down singles stalwart Tyson McGuffin. Sock’s forehand gave McGuffin all sorts of problems as he eventually pulled away in the third to take the match 11-2 in the deciding game. It setups a very intriguing QF with Cason Campbell, the Cinderella story of the tournament thus far. The 17 year old has defeated both Collin Shick and Dylan Frazier to get to this point but going up against Sock on center court tomorrow will be a different type of challenge for him.

Women’s Singles: Parenteau Impressive in Opening Round

Catherine Parenteau is back in the singles draw after taking singles off at the PPA Desert Ridge. She put together a business-like effort defeating Ekaterina Biakina in two games, dropping just five total points. She will face #5 seed Salome Devidze tomorrow for the right to play the winner of Mary Brascia and Lauren Stratman.

Mixed Doubles: Sock & Parenteau Advance to QF

Sock & Parenteau made quick work of Devilliers/Smith 4 &2 today and will take on  the #1 seeds Ben Johns and Anna Leigh Waters tomorrow. The last time Johns and Waters did not walk away with the trophy in mixed doubles was back at the PPA Mesa last year. Can Sock & Parenteau dethrone what has been an unbeatable mixed team for the last 12 months? Out of all the teams in the draw they are the greatest threat on paper so make sure to tune into that one tomorrow. On the bottom half of the draw, we have a few rematches from the Hyundai Masters as Ignatowich/Bright will face McGuffin/Dizon and David/Wilson will go head-to-head with Newman/Jackie Kawamoto.

Men’s Doubles: Johns Brothers Defeat Opens up Draw

Andrei Daescu and Gabe Tardio came into their round of 16 match as big underdogs but they didn't play like it at all. They were very aggressive from the jump and had the Johns brothers on their heels the entire match. They walked away with an 11-6 11-5 victory in an absolute shocker to cap off the night session. The door is now open for the likes of Dylan Frazier and JW Johnson, who have proven themselves to be the #2 men's doubles team over the past year.

Women’s Doubles: Brascia’s Win the Selkirk Sister Showdown

Mary Brascia was the difference maker in the Selkirk sister showdown today. She played a much more aggressive right side as she and sister Maggie defeated the Kawamoto twins, after two prior defeats to start the year. The draw doesn’t get any easier as they will face Meghan Dizon/Etta Wright tomorrow. On the top half of the draw Waters/Parenteau defeated Braverman/Maddox 2 &2. They will get Rane/Oshiro in the QF who are fresh off an APP title in Punta Gorda.
